To answer that question yes i used the stock 240 throttle cable and stock SR throttle cable bracket now i thought you allready new this but when you use the greddy manifold you have to get and must get the S14 SR throttle body pully just for that it makes it look alot cleaner an you make use of the cable and stock SR throttle cable and stock sr bracket its like 25 bux on frsport read the product description
http://www.frsport.com/Genuine....html . Anyway theirs a write up on it somewere but i think i said pretty much all their is for that issue good luck with it, it sure is clean lookin though.
